Critical temperature of a two-band superconductor with account for interband pairing

Abstract

Dependence of the critical temperature of a superconductor with two overlapping conduction bands on the band filling is considered. The electrons are assumed to have parabolic dispersion laws and to interact within a layer near the Fermi surface. For superconductors with interband Cooper pairing the superconducting transition temperature as a function of the carrier density is nonmonotonic and resembles the analogous dependence in high-temperature superconductors.
